About Patrick DePotter
Patrick DePotter is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Epidemiology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Molecular Biology and Genetics, having authored 14 papers that have together received 282 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ocular Oncology and Treatments (12 papers), Nonmelanoma Skin Cancer Studies (4 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(3 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(2 papers), Corneal Surgery and Treatments (2 papers), Genetic and rare skin diseases. (2 papers),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(2 papers) and Cancer and Skin Lesions (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(238 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(70 citations), Dermatology (24 citations), Oncology (68 citations) and Genetics (21 citations). Patrick DePotter has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Jerry A. Shields, Carol L. Shields, Jerry A. Shields, Carol L. Shields, Carol L. Shields, J. Carlos Hernandez, Luther W. Brady, Hayyam Kıratlı, Robert P. Schroeder and Ralph C. Eagle.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Pediatric Ophthalmology & Strabismus, American Journal of Ophthalmology, Retina, International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ics and British Journal of Ophthalmology.
